Want to read a different kind of mystery? If you like you mysteries loaded down with description then this is the book for you! This story is based in and around an in vitro fertilization clinic in Mississippi.
The author takes us through page after page of description when finally, we meet somebody.
We meet Officer Saybeck and his wife, both of whom want a baby in the worst way. When we meet the Saybecks, Mrs. Saybeck is being rushed to the hospital emergency room for internal bleeding. The last Officer Saybeck sees his wife she is being rushed into the operating room with blood transfusions dripping into both arms.
After the operation, the doctor speaks to worried Officer Saybeck. Does the doctor inform him that his wife is alive and recovering? No. The good doctor isn’t that compassionate. Instead, he drums up business for his in vitro fertilization clinic. I think this doctor needs to learn some people skills.
After we leave the good doctor and the Saybecks, we go back to pages and pages of description again. It goes on like this throughout the book. In fact, you don’t find a dead body until you’re half way through the book! It’s very rare that I read a book that I can’t wait to put down but this is one of them.
I don’t recommend this book at all.
